In Germany, buying a parrot includes sticking to particular legal requirements. It's essential to think about the following:
CITES Regulations: Many parrot types are safeguarded under the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species (CITES). Guarantee that the seller provides a CITES certificate for any species that falls under this guideline.
Origin and Welfare: Germany has strict animal welfare laws. Constantly purchase from trustworthy breeders or certified family pet stores that follow the policies concerning animal well-being.
Microchipping: Certain species require microchipping. Acquaint yourself with the requirements particular to the species you wish to purchase.

Caring for Your Parrot
As soon as you've invited a parrot into your home, comprehending its care is vital. Here are some fundamental care tips:
Socializing: Spend time everyday with your parrot to construct trust and friendship. Parrots are social animals that grow on interaction.
Nutrition: Provide a balanced diet plan, including pellets, seeds, fruits, and vegetables. Prevent avocados and chocolate, as these are harmful to parrots.

FAQs
1. What is the average lifespan of a parrot?Parrots usually have long lifespans, varying by types. Smaller types like budgerigars may live between 5-10 years, while larger species like African Grey parrots can live up to 60 years or Wo Kann Man Papagei Kaufen more.
2. Can I train my parrot to talk?Yes, specifically species like the African Grey and Amazon parrots. Constant interaction and favorable support can help in teaching them various words and phrases.
3. Is it much better to buy a single parrot or a pair?It depends upon the owner's schedule for social interaction. Single parrots can bond carefully with their owners, while pairs can provide friendship for each other. Nevertheless, handling 2 parrots can be more requiring.
4. What should I do if my parrot stops consuming?Consult a veterinarian instantly. Modifications in consuming habits can suggest health concerns. Offering a variety of food choices might likewise assist stimulate their cravings.
